What is an equation of the line that passes through the points (4, -2) and (-1, 3)?

Answer:

x+y-2=0

Explanation:

here,

(4,-2)=(x1,y1)

(-1,3)=(X2,y2)

Now,by using two point formula,

y-y1=y2-y1/x2-x1(x-x1)

or,y+2=3+2/-1-4(x-4)

or,y+2=5/-5(x-4)

or,y+2=-1(x-4)

or,y+2=-x+4

or,x+y+2-4=0

or,x+y-2=0(which is req. eqn.)
